Biography
Kazimierz Dziurzyński was a dedicated Polish military officer who served his nation during a pivotal period in European history. Born in 1891, he came of age during the struggle for Polish independence and contributed to the development of the Polish armed forces in the years following World War I.
Colonel Dziurzyński perished in 1940 during the Soviet campaign against Polish military leadership. His memory is preserved at the Katyn Polish War Cemetery, where he rests among thousands of fellow officers and soldiers who fell victim to one of history's most devastating massacres.
